== Description ==

**Content Refresh Assistant** is built for the post-AI SEO era: maintaining and improving existing content beats constantly publishing new posts.

In 10 minutes you get:

- A refresh diagnosis (score + priority)
- A step-by-step refresh plan (actionable tasks)
- Internal link suggestions as bonus value inside the refresh workflow

No tracking. No ads. Lightweight by design.

= Key Features =

* Refresh Score (0-100) + Priority (P0/P1/P2)
* Actionable Refresh Plan tasks (e.g., update_intro, fix_structure_headings)
* Internal link suggestions (top related posts)
* Fast metrics: word count, reading time, days since update, link counts
* Works inside WP Admin (Tools → Content Refresh)

== Installation ==

1. Upload the plugin to the `/wp-content/plugins/` directory, or install it from the WordPress plugin screen.
2. Activate the plugin through the 'Plugins' screen.
3. Go to Tools → Content Refresh, select a post, and click "Generate Refresh Plan".

== Frequently Asked Questions ==

= Does this plugin send data to external servers? =

No. By default, all analysis is performed on your WordPress site. (Optional AI-assisted features may be added later as opt-in.)

= Who can use this plugin? =

Users need the `edit_posts` capability.

= Will this slow down my site? =

The plugin is designed to be lightweight. It analyzes a single selected post on demand.

= Where do I find it after activation? =

WP Admin → Tools → Content Refresh.

= Does it modify my content automatically? =

No. It generates a plan and suggestions. Applying changes is manual.
